  1. sheet anchor


    • n.
      an additional anchor for use in emergencies.;a very dependable person or thing.
    • noun: sheet anchor, plural noun: sheet anchors

    • n.
      A large extra anchor intended for use in an emergency.
    • IPA[SHēt ˈaNGkər]


    • n.
      a person or thing that is very dependable and relied upon in the last resort.

    Oxford American Dictionary